Rome2Rio

How to get fromPrince Rupert to Salt Spring Islandby bus, plane, train or ferry

Find Transport to Salt Spring Island

See all options

There are 3 ways to get from Prince Rupert to Salt Spring Island by bus, plane, train, or ferry

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Bus to Northwest Regional Airport, fly

    best
    1. Take the bus from Prince Rupert to Terrance Skeena Mallbus bus
    2. Fly from Northwest Regional Airport (YXT) to Ganges Harbor (YGG)plane plane YXT - YGG
    7h 8m
    $124–595
  2. Train, ferry

    1. Take the train from Prince Rupert to Jaspertrain train
    2. Take the train from Jasper to Vancouvertrain train
    3. Take the ferry from Vancouver to Salt Spring Islandferry ferry
    9d 2h
    $12,493–12,640
  3. Train to Smithers Airport, fly

    1. Take the train from Prince Rupert to Smitherstrain train
    2. Fly from Smithers Airport (YYD) to Ganges Harbor (YGG)plane plane YYD - YGG
    12h 21m
    $137–602

Northwest Regional Airport (YXT) to Ganges Harbor (YGG) flights

Calendar28Weekly Planes
Duration4h 25mAverage Duration
Ticket$91Cheapest Price
See schedules

Questions & Answers

What companies run services between Prince Rupert, BC, Canada and Salt Spring Island, BC, Canada?

There is no direct connection from Prince Rupert to Salt Spring Island. However, you can take the bus to Terrance Skeena Mall, walk to Lakelse at Skeena Mall, take the line 11 bus to Terminal at Bristol, walk to Northwest Regional Airport (YXT) airport, then fly to Ganges Harbor (YGG). Alternatively, you can take a train from Prince Rupert to Salt Spring Island via Jasper, Vancouver, Vancouver City Centre Station @ Platform 2, Bridgeport Station @ Platform 2, Bridgeport Station @ Bay 12, Tsawwassen Ferry Terminal @ Bay 1, and Vancouver in around 9d 2h.

Airlines
Train operators
Bus operators
Ferry operators

Want to know more about travelling around the world?

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including How to get from Southend Airport into central London, Flying into Beijing?, and Italy Travel Guides - to help you get the most out of your next trip.